The HTML5 graphic area provides a versatile way to generate dynamic visuals and animations directly within your web browser. Unlike traditional image formats like JPEG or PNG, the drawing surface isn’t a static graphic; it’s a rectangular region where you can render anything you desire using JavaScript. You're essentially scripting the image itself! Initially, you need to get a reference to the canvas element using JavaScript's `document.getElementById()` process and then obtain a 2D graphic context. This context provides the methods to actually start rendering lines, shapes, text, and even complex layouts. The graphic area is inherently a raster environment, meaning graphics are composed of individual pixels, offering fine-grained control over every detail, although it also demands careful consideration of efficiency when dealing with large or complex drawings.
Utilizing the HTML5 Development
The modern web arena is profoundly shaped by the capabilities offered through the HTML5 development. Programmers are increasingly exploiting this powerful toolset to produce dynamic and immersive web experiences. Rather than being confined to static content, websites can now incorporate sophisticated capabilities, including rich media, custom graphics, and robust multimedia support, due to the enhanced platform that HTML5 provides. Furthermore, understanding how to effectively control the different APIs available within the HTML5 toolset allows for the creation of applications that function across a broad spectrum of devices, promoting a truly accessible and unified web experience. The potential for creativity is vast, making proficiency with the HTML5 engine an vital skill for anyone involved in web construction.
HTML Game Creation with Canvas
Delving into HTML5 game building can seem daunting at first, but leveraging the The Canvas element significantly simplifies the workflow. The Canvas provides a versatile area within your webpage where you can draw graphics using JavaScript, enabling you to design dynamic and engaging game experiences. Unlike older technologies, HTML The Canvas development doesn’t require plugins, making your games accessible to a larger audience. You can use a range of JavaScript libraries and frameworks, like Phaser or PixiJS, to further accelerate your output in making visually appealing games. This approach grants you substantial influence over every aspect of your game's visuals and logic, opening up possibilities for truly unique and innovative game designs!
Delving into HTML5 Canvas for Interactive Graphics
HTML5 canvas provides a powerful environment for creating interactive graphics directly within your web browsers. Unlike traditional static formats, this surface allows for live manipulation of pixels, permitting developers to construct everything from simple animations to complex games and data visualizations. Leveraging JavaScript, you can effectively render shapes, apply filters, and answer to user interaction, reshaping the canvas right away. The potential for imaginative expression is vast, allowing HTML5 this drawing area a essential tool for modern web programming.
Exploring HTML5 Animation Techniques
Creating dynamic visuals on the web has never been easier, thanks to the power of HTML5. Several approaches allow developers to create remarkable animated content without relying on outside plugins like Flash. These include using CSS animated properties, which offer great control over timing and transitions; utilizing the `
The HTML5 Creation Engine: A Developer's Manual
For contemporary web creation, the HTML5 Creation Engine has become an vital asset. This article presents a complete examination of its capabilities, aiming to assist coders in building powerful and check here groundbreaking web applications. We'll examine into key components, covering everything from basic concepts to sophisticated techniques. Understanding this engine is important for someone aspiring to function effectively in the changing world of web creation. Expect to grasp how to employ its integrated capabilities to simplify your process and deliver exceptional results.